directions

  • Combine the water and the sugars in a saucepan.
  • Heat until boiling over medium heat and until all the sugar is dissolved.
  • Remove from the heat and let mixture cool for about 15 minutes.
  • Add the vodka, almond extract and vanilla extract.
  • Store in a sealed bottle.
